This spooky season, cult classic The Rocky Horror Picture Show is returning to our very own Vic Theatre for five showings of kooky fun.

Running from October 25th all the way until Halloween night, it’s that time of year to put on your fishnets, wig, and little gold shorts for an interactive show you’re surely not to forget.

Whether you’re a Rocky Horror newbie or a seasoned veteran fan, the Vic Theatre promises to host a fantastic night featuring a lively host – to indoctrinate Rocky Horror virgins, of course – a costume contest, and all of the rice-tossing, newsprint-hoisting, interactive madness you can dream of.

In this highly acclaimed and famed screening, sweethearts Brad (Barry Bostwick) and Janet (Susan Sarandon), stuck with a flat tire during a storm, discover the eerie mansion of Dr. Frank-N-Furter (Tim Curry), a transvestite scientist.

As their innocence is lost, Brad and Janet meet a houseful of wild characters, including a rocking biker (Meat Loaf) and a creepy butler (Richard O’Brien). Through elaborate dances and rock songs, Frank-N-Furter unveils his latest creation: a muscular man named “Rocky.”
